Similar presentations:
Что такое микроконтроллер
1.
§Что такоемикроконтроллер?
Андреева Ю.А.
2.
1.1 Как научить электронную платудумать:
микроконтроллеры и компьютеры
3.
На наших занятиях мы будем зажигать лампочки, воспроизводитьзвук, отображать текст. Мы научим электронную плату
реагировать на свет, тепло и наклон. Мы научимся подключать
кнопки и регуляторы. Мы будем вращать двигатели и
поворачивать их на строго заданный угол. И, наконец, соберём
настоящего работа, который будет ездить вдоль нарисованной
вами линии.
Все это было бы довольно сложно или даже практически невозможно
без одного очень важного компонента - микроконтроллера
Микроконтроллер – это небольшая микросхема, в которой уже
есть процессор, оперативная память, и флеш-память. Они
бывают разной формы, немного различаются возможностями и
производительностью, но суть остается неизменной.
4.
Микроконтроллер часто является мозговым центром платы,отвечающей за определенную задачу: на него приходят все
сигналы, поступающие на плату, а он в свою очередь раздает
команды всем устройствам, подключенным к ней.
Микроконтроллеры используются повсеместно: от бытовых
кухонных устройств до элементов управления космическом
кораблем, от домофонов до систем безопасности в автомобиле, от
радиоуправляемых игрушек до роботов на конвейере заводы.
5.
1.2 Как сделать электронику проще:Arduino
6.
Электронная плата Arduino позволяет нам заметноупростить все процессы. Все нужные компоненты на
ней уже есть. Программный код получается намного
проще из-за того, что большая его часть уже
написана. Для микроконтроллера не нужен
специальный программатор, т.к. программы
загружаются на микроконтроллер через USB при
помощи специального приложения на компьютере.
7.
8.
9.
1.3 Как управлять Arduino:среда разработки
10.
Мы будем работать в программе, которая называетсясредой разработки.
11.
В центральную часть окна пишется программный коддля управления микроконтроллером. Такой код так же
называется скетчем. Программный код – это просто
текст, написанный на специальном языке, который
понятен и человеку и компьютеру.
Нажав на кнопку «Verify»
, вы сможете проверить
свой код на правильность. Если после нажатия на неё
в нижней части окна появится надпись «Done
compiling», значит, вы написали все правильно. В
противном случае вы увидите сообщение об ошибке.
12.
13.
Чтобы написанный вами скетч перенесся скомпьютера на микроконтроллер Arduino, нужно
загрузить его.
Процесс загрузки так же называется прошивкой или
заливкой. Это можно сделать при помощи кнопки
«Upload»
. Точно так же при удачной загрузке
внизу появится строка «Done uploading»
14.
1.4 Как заставить Arduino мигатьлампочкой: светодиод
15.
Если вы посмотрите на плату Arduino, то увидите наней несколько маленьких лампочек, которые
называют светодиодами
16.
Для того, чтобы заставить одну из лампочек мигатьнам необходимо:
1. Подключить плату через USB к компьютеру
2. Пропишите в среду разработки код
3. Нажмите кнопку Upload. Подождите некоторое
время. Светодиод, подписанный буквой L, начнет
мигать.